vue.js可以写什么项目

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Vue.js是一种流行的JavaScript框架,常用于构建用户界面。它的灵活性和易用性使得它适用于各种项目。下面我将介绍一些适合使用Vue.js的项目类型。

    1. 单页应用(SPA):Vue.js非常适合构建单页应用。SPA通过在一个页面上动态加载内容来提供更快的用户体验,而不需要每次加载新页面。Vue.js的组件化架构和路由功能使得构建SPA变得更加简单。

    2. 前端框架:Vue.js可以作为一个前端框架来构建响应式的Web应用程序。它提供了一套强大的工具和库,使得开发人员可以方便地管理应用程序的状态、数据和用户界面。

    3. 移动应用:Vue.js与Cordova或React Native等移动应用开发框架的集成非常好。通过使用Vue.js,开发人员可以构建跨平台的移动应用,并使用相同的代码库在多个平台上开发。

    4. 后台管理系统:Vue.js的数据绑定和组件化能力使得它非常适合构建后台管理系统。它可以轻松地管理和显示大量的数据,并提供友好的用户界面来管理数据。

    5. 数据可视化应用:Vue.js与D3.js等数据可视化库的结合可以创建出令人印象深刻的数据可视化应用。Vue.js的响应式数据绑定和组件化特性可以帮助开发人员有效地管理和显示数据。

    总之,Vue.js是一个功能强大、灵活、易用的JavaScript框架,适用于各种项目类型。无论您是构建单页应用、前端框架、移动应用、后台管理系统还是数据可视化应用,Vue.js都是一个很好的选择。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Vue.js 是一个用于构建用户界面的 JavaScript 框架。它使用了轻量级的虚拟 DOM,并结合了反应性的数据绑定,使得开发高效、灵活和易于维护的前端应用程序成为可能。因此,Vue.js 可以用于开发各种类型的项目,包括:

    1. 单页面应用(SPA):Vue.js 最擅长构建单页面应用,通过路由器(Vue Router)实现不同页面之间的切换,使用户在不同页面之间流畅地进行导航。Vue.js 使用虚拟 DOM 技术确保了快速的渲染和响应速度。这使得 Vue.js 成为构建交互式 Web 应用程序的理想选择。

    2. 前端框架:Vue.js 可以作为前端框架来构建各种类型的网站和应用程序。它提供了组件化的开发方式,使得前端开发人员可以将页面拆分为多个模块化的组件,并使这些组件更易于维护和重用。通过使用 Vue.js,开发人员可以以更清晰的结构编写前端代码。

    3. 移动应用程序:Vue.js 可以与 Cordova、Ionic 等移动应用程序开发框架结合使用,用于构建跨平台的移动应用程序。Vue.js 提供了 Vue Native,允许开发人员使用 Vue.js 和 React Native 组件来构建原生移动应用程序。这使得开发移动应用程序变得更加容易和高效。

    4. 桌面应用程序:Vue.js 可以与 Electron 等桌面应用程序开发框架结合使用,用于构建桌面应用程序。通过将 Vue.js 和一些原生 Node.js 模块结合使用,开发人员可以使用 Vue.js 构建出美观、高效的桌面应用程序,并以应用程序的形式在不同操作系统上进行分发。

    5. 前后端分离项目:Vue.js 可以与后端框架(如 Spring Boot、Django 等)结合使用,实现前后端分离的开发模式。通过使用 Vue.js,前端开发人员可以独立于后端进行开发,并通过 RESTful API 与后端进行数据交互。这种分离的开发模式提高了开发效率,并使得前后端开发团队可以独立工作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Vue.js是一种用于构建用户界面的JavaScript框架,它可以用来开发各种类型的Web应用程序。以下是一些可以使用Vue.js开发的项目类型:

    1. 单页面应用(SPA):Vue.js非常适合开发单页面应用,因为它提供了路由器和状态管理工具,可以轻松管理应用程序的不同状态并进行页面切换。使用Vue.js可以创建具有动态数据绑定和组件化结构的现代SPA。

    2. 响应式网站:Vue.js可以用来构建响应式网站,它可以根据用户设备的屏幕大小和分辨率自动调整网站的布局和样式。通过使用Vue.js的响应式组件和指令,可以实现不同设备上的优雅和用户友好的网站。

    3. 移动应用程序:借助Vue.js的一些插件和工具,可以使用Vue.js开发移动应用程序。Vue.js可以与Cordova或Ionic等混合应用框架集成,以创建跨平台的移动应用程序。

    4. 桌面应用程序:除了开发Web应用程序外,Vue.js还可以使用Electron将应用程序包装为桌面应用程序。通过使用Vue.js和Electron,可以创建具有原生操作系统访问能力的跨平台桌面应用程序。

    5. 插件和库:Vue.js也可以用于开发插件和库,以便其他人可以在其项目中使用。Vue.js为开发人员提供了许多工具和生态系统,可以用于创建功能强大且易于维护的插件和库。

    总结起来,使用Vue.js可以开发各种类型的Web应用程序,包括单页面应用、响应式网站、移动应用程序、桌面应用程序以及插件和库。Vue.js的灵活性和易用性使其成为开发者喜爱的选择。无论是初学者还是有经验的开发人员,都可以使用Vue.js来构建出色的项目。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部